Zane Smith Returning to GMS in 2021

Zane Smith will continue his tenure at GMS Racing in the NASCAR Gander RV & Outdoors Truck Series next season, the team announced today, Oct. 12.

The driver of the No. 21 Chevrolet Silverado has had a breakout season with the organization this season, winning two races along with 10 top-10 finishes.

Smith’s truck number for 2021 was not specified in the release.

The 21-year-old advanced to the Round of 8 of the playoffs and is currently sitting in third in the standings.

2020 has been Smith’s first full-time season in the Truck Series after a part-time run at JR Motorsports in 2019.

“I’m just thankful to Maury (Gallagher), Mike Beam, Chevrolet and all of GMS Racing,” Smith said in a release. “It was one thing to be full time for such a good race team like GMS, but to get to do it again is a whole other thing. It takes a lot of pressure off myself going into this final round of the playoffs knowing I have a job next year. Now there is a good kind of pressure and that’s winning the championship in my rookie year. I can’t wait to be back full-time next season with the knowledge and experience I have now.”

The Truck Series returns to action Oct. 17 for the Clean Harbors 200 at Kansas Speedway. Smith will look to lock a spot into the Championship 4.
